AL Hayat Medical University Teaching Hospital

1. Purpose and Role:

  • Education and Training: The hospital serves as a primary training site for medical students, residents, and fellows. It provides hands-on clinical experience and supervision under experienced faculty.
  • Research: It often supports research activities, including clinical trials and studies that contribute to advancements in medical science.

2. Services:

  • Clinical Care: The hospital offers a wide range of medical services, including emergency care, specialized treatments, surgeries, and outpatient services.
  • Specialties: It typically has various departments such as internal medicine, surgery, pediatrics, obstetrics and gynecology, and more.

3. Facilities:

  • State-of-the-Art Equipment: Teaching hospitals often feature advanced medical technologies and facilities.
  • Educational Resources: Includes simulation labs, conference rooms for lectures, and library resources for students and staff.

4. Faculty and Staff:

  • Experienced Professionals: Staffed by experienced doctors, surgeons, and specialists who also teach and mentor students.
  • Multidisciplinary Teams: Collaborative approach to patient care, involving different specialties working together.

5. Location and Community Impact:

  • Regional Influence: The hospital plays a significant role in the healthcare system of its region, providing essential services and contributing to community health.
  • Collaborations: It might collaborate with other medical institutions, research organizations, and public health entities.
